In the Linux kernel, the following vulnerability has been resolved:

s390/cio: Fix device lifecycle handling in css_alloc_subchannel()

`css_alloc_subchannel()` calls `device_initialize()` before setting up
the DMA masks. If `dma_set_coherent_mask()` or `dma_set_mask()` fails,
the error path frees the subchannel structure directly, bypassing
the device model reference counting.

Once `device_initialize()` has been called, the embedded struct device
must be released via `put_device()`, allowing the release callback to
free the container structure.

Fix the error path by dropping the initial device reference with
`put_device()` instead of calling `kfree()` directly.

This ensures correct device lifetime handling and avoids potential
use-after-free or double-free issues.
